Returning the AT-S107 Management Software to the Factory Default Values

This procedure returns all AT-S107 Management software parameters to their default values and deletes all tagged and port-based VLANs on the switch.

This procedure causes the switch to reboot. The switch does not forward network traffic during the reboot process. Some network traffic may be lost.

To return the AT-S107 Management software to the default settings, do the following procedure:

1.From the Tools folder, select Reboot.

The Reboot Page is shown in Figure 14 on page 32.

2.For the Reboot Type field, use the pull-down menu to select one of the following:

Factory Default

Resets all switch parameters to the factory default settings, including the IP address, subnet mask, and gateway address.

Warning

This setting will cause the IP address to be reset to 192.168.1.1. You will loose connectivity with the switch management software after the reboot is completed

Factory Default Except IP Address

Resets all switch parameters to the factory default settings, but retains the IP address, subnet mask, and gateway settings. If the DHCP client is enabled, it remains enabled after this reset.

3.For the Reboot Status field, use the pull-down menu to select Start to begin the reboot.

4.Click Apply.

The switch is rebooted. You must wait for the switch to complete the reboot process before establishing your management session again.
